About This Book

Health Science Fundamentals, Revised First Edition provides students the skills they need to become competent and productive health care workers throughout their careers, with a strong emphasis on employability skills such as teamwork, effective communication, professionalism, and medical ethics. To emphasize these career skills, the text is divided into two parts. The first part, Becoming a Health Care Worker, includes basic information all health care workers must have to attain success in any health care field. The second part, Health Care Knowledge and Skills, covers the technical concepts and clinical skills students need to gain employment in a variety of entry-level occupations. - Back cover.
